41 | | /* |
42 | | * Lossless image transformation routines. These routines work on DCT |
43 | | * coefficient arrays and thus do not require any lossy decompression |
44 | | * or recompression of the image. |
45 | | * Thanks to Guido Vollbeding for the initial design and code of this feature, |
46 | | * and to Ben Jackson for introducing the cropping feature. |
47 | | * |
48 | | * Horizontal flipping is done in-place, using a single top-to-bottom |
49 | | * pass through the virtual source array. It will thus be much the |
50 | | * fastest option for images larger than main memory. |
51 | | * |
52 | | * The other routines require a set of destination virtual arrays, so they |
53 | | * need twice as much memory as jpegtran normally does. The destination |
54 | | * arrays are always written in normal scan order (top to bottom) because |
55 | | * the virtual array manager expects this. The source arrays will be scanned |
56 | | * in the corresponding order, which means multiple passes through the source |
57 | | * arrays for most of the transforms. That could result in much thrashing |
58 | | * if the image is larger than main memory. |
59 | | * |
60 | | * If cropping or trimming is involved, the destination arrays may be smaller |
61 | | * than the source arrays. Note it is not possible to do horizontal flip |
62 | | * in-place when a nonzero Y crop offset is specified, since we'd have to move |
63 | | * data from one block row to another but the virtual array manager doesn't |
64 | | * guarantee we can touch more than one row at a time. So in that case, |
65 | | * we have to use a separate destination array. |
66 | | * |
67 | | * Some notes about the operating environment of the individual transform |
68 | | * routines: |
69 | | * 1. Both the source and destination virtual arrays are allocated from the |
70 | | * source JPEG object, and therefore should be manipulated by calling the |
71 | | * source's memory manager. |
72 | | * 2. The destination's component count should be used. It may be smaller |
73 | | * than the source's when forcing to grayscale. |
74 | | * 3. Likewise the destination's sampling factors should be used. When |
75 | | * forcing to grayscale the destination's sampling factors will be all 1, |
76 | | * and we may as well take that as the effective iMCU size. |
77 | | * 4. When "trim" is in effect, the destination's dimensions will be the |
78 | | * trimmed values but the source's will be untrimmed. |
79 | | * 5. When "crop" is in effect, the destination's dimensions will be the |
80 | | * cropped values but the source's will be uncropped. Each transform |
81 | | * routine is responsible for picking up source data starting at the |
82 | | * correct X and Y offset for the crop region. (The X and Y offsets |
83 | | * passed to the transform routines are measured in iMCU blocks of the |
84 | | * destination.) |
85 | | * 6. All the routines assume that the source and destination buffers are |
86 | | * padded out to a full iMCU boundary. This is true, although for the |
87 | | * source buffer it is an undocumented property of jdcoefct.c. |
88 | | */ |
